Job Summary
- Reporting directly to the CEO, the Executive Assistant provides executive support in a one-on-one working relationship.
- He/she serves as the primary point of contact for internal and external constituencies on all matters pertaining to the CEO’s Office, serving as a liaison to existing and prospective clients, other staff, independent consultants and contractors.
- In addition, organizes and coordinates executive outreach and external relations efforts and oversees special projects.
Roles and Responsibilities
- Completes a broad variety of administrative tasks for the CEO including: managing an active calendar of appointments; completing expense reports; composing and preparing correspondence that is sometimes confidential; arranging detailed travel plans, itineraries, and agendas; and compiling documents for meetings and presentations.
- Plans, coordinates and ensures the CEO's schedule is followed and respected. Provides "gatekeeper" and "gateway" role, optimising access to and utilisation of the CEO's time and office.
- Communicates directly, and on behalf of the CEO, with other staff, clients, independent consultants, contractors, etc to keep projects on track and optimize the CEO's time and availability.
- Works closely and effectively with the CEO to keep him/her well informed of upcoming commitments and responsibilities, following up appropriately.
- Acts as a "barometer," having a sense for the issues taking place in the environment and keeping the CEO updated.
- Uses initiative and maturity to build relationships crucial to the success of the organization, and manages a variety of special projects for the CEO, many of which may have organizational impact.
- Successfully completes critical aspects of deliverables with a hands-on approach, including drafting acknowledgement letters, personal correspondence, and other tasks that facilitate the CEO's ability to effectively lead the company.
- Prioritizes conflicting needs; handles matter expeditiously, proactively, and follows-through on projects to successful completion, often with deadlines.
